Scissero is a legal-technology company that provides a cloud-based platform to convert contracts and other legal documents into structured, machine-readable data. It uses natural language processing and machine learning to extract clauses, metadata, and obligations, and exposes integrations and APIs so enterprises and legal teams can embed contract intelligence into workflows and automation. The product is offered as a B2B SaaS with developer-friendly interfaces for downstream systems and compliance processes.

• Review and negotiate commercial contracts, including vendor agreements, data processing addenda, confidentiality agreements and engagement letters. • Apply client-specific playbooks and structured frameworks to ensure alignment with agreed client positions. • Identify deviations from playbook positions and implement appropriate fallback language. • Review the work of junior team members and assist with professional development and ongoing training. • Manage workflow and document queue while meeting defined turnaround times and service levels. • Collaborate with colleagues across the global legal team to ensure consistent, high-quality delivery. • Work directly with internal stakeholders to maintain operational efficiency and service excellence. • Contribute to wider business projects, including improving the legal team operating model. • Use proprietary AI tools to accelerate document review and enhance accuracy and consistency. • Maintain oversight of legal output and ensure deliverables meet client and internal quality standards. • Provide structured feedback to product and engineering teams to improve the AI platform. • Work within an AI-native legal delivery model combining legal expertise with technology.
• Admitted US attorney. • 3+ years post qualification experience drafting, reviewing and negotiating core commercial documents. • Interest in developing client management skills at pace, with a view to taking ownership of client relationships in due course. • Excellent written and spoken English. • Strong attention to detail and commitment to producing consistently high-quality work. •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a global/remote team. • Strong ownership mindset and accountability for work product. • Ability to operate effectively in high-volume, deadline-driven environments. • Excellent organizational and time management skills. • Collaborative approach and ability to work effectively as part of a global team. • Professionalism and clear communication. • Interest in legal technology and innovation.
• 401(k) Retirement Plan: Access to a company-sponsored 401(k) plan to help you save for the future. • Company-contributed medical, dental and vision coverage • Hybrid and remote working options, with the ability to request to work from other countries (upon request) • Paid Sick Leave: 7 days per year • Employee Assistance Program (EAP) offering mental health and wellbeing support • Professional Development: 7 days per year of paid study leave annually for exams and structured learning • Annual Bonus: Discretionary and performance-based • 25 days paid vacation, plus company holidays • Professional growth and development in a tech-enabled environment • Opportunity to work with a diverse and innovative global client base • Learn from experienced professionals across multiple disciplines and jurisdictions
